Whats your question? do you want to know how to bleed the mastercylinder or the entire brake system? Normally when replacing the master I bleed it on the bench, I put the master cylinder in a vise, fill it up and start pumping it with my hand to get the air out. Install the master and bleed the brake system. This is pretty easy too. Have your little brother or your Mom sit in the car while you start from the right rear wheel. Tell them to pump it up and hold it, as you open the bleeder screw. Fluid will squirt out everywhere. Do this about 9-10 times per wheel, be sure to keep the master cylinder full of fluid when your doing this. Dont let it go dry.
